Thomas the Tank Engine Returns to Duluth
DULUTH, Minn. — Chaguuh-chaguuh Thomas who? Thomas the Tank Engine is back once again at the North Shore Railroad in Duluth. Thomas comes from the Island of Sodor, United Kingdom’s fictional home of engines. When he’s in town, thousands travel from across the country to see him. “Generations have grown up with Thomas. Grandparents were Thomas enthusiasts, parents were Thomas…


